What a retaining wall solves

A retaining wall does one job: hold soil where it belongs. On the Western Slope that usually means stopping a slope from washing into a driveway or yard, creating usable flat ground on a steep lot, or keeping soil loads and runoff off a foundation during grading and landscaping.

Most of the calls we get fall into three buckets — property erosion, terracing a steep slope, and protecting a foundation while a site is being regraded or landscaped.

New retaining wall design and installation

We start with the slope, the soil, and the water. Wall height, base depth, batter, reinforcement, and drainage are all designed around the load the wall actually has to carry — not a standard detail applied everywhere. Taller walls get engineered plans and permits where the jurisdiction requires them.

The base is where walls live or die. We over-excavate, compact engineered aggregate, and set the first course dead level before a single block or timber goes up.

Repair and replacement of failing walls

A wall that is leaning, bulging, or shedding blocks is telling you the backfill is saturated, the base has failed, or the wall was undersized for the load. We inspect all three before recommending anything.

If the base is sound and the failure traces back to drainage or a few damaged courses, repair plus new drainage often saves the wall. When the base has given way or the original design was too light, replacement is the honest answer — and we say so.

Concrete or timber — choosing the right wall

Concrete block and poured walls carry more load, reach taller heights, and stand up to moisture and freeze-thaw for decades. Timber costs less and looks right on shorter landscape walls and garden terracing, but it has a shorter service life in wet ground.

We recommend based on wall height, soil load, water exposure, access for equipment, and the finished look you want — then price both when it is a close call.

Drainage: why walls fail and how we prevent it

Nearly every failed retaining wall we are called out to has the same root cause — water trapped behind it. Saturated backfill is heavy, hydrostatic pressure pushes outward, and freeze-thaw at elevation ratchets the wall forward a little more each winter.

That is why drainage is part of every wall we build: washed rock behind the face, filter fabric to keep fines out of the rock, a perforated drain line at the base, and a discharge point that carries water somewhere safe. Where a wall sits near a house, we tie that into a French drain or foundation drainage plan.

  • Washed rock drainage zone behind the wall
  • Filter fabric separating soil from the rock
  • Perforated drain pipe with a proper outlet
  • Surface grading and downspout routing above the wall
  • Integration with French drains and foundation drainage

Built for Western Colorado slopes and soils

Expansive Mancos clay in the Grand Valley, river-valley water tables along the Colorado and Roaring Fork, gypsum-bearing soils in Eagle County, and hard freeze-thaw cycling at elevation all change how a wall has to be built. A wall detail that works in Fruita is not the wall we build in Aspen.

We work throughout Mesa, Garfield, Pitkin, and Eagle counties, and design each wall for the ground it is actually standing in.

How a retaining wall project runs

  1. 01

    Free on-site evaluation

    We walk the slope, trace where water runs, and measure what the wall has to hold back.

  2. 02

    Design and written price

    You get wall type, height, drainage detail, and a fixed price — plus engineered plans and permits when the height requires them.

  3. 03

    Excavation and compacted base

    We over-excavate, place and compact engineered aggregate, and set the first course level and true.

  4. 04

    Wall build with drainage

    Courses go in with proper batter and reinforcement, backed by washed rock, filter fabric, and a drain line.

  5. 05

    Backfill, grading, and walkthrough

    Backfill is compacted in lifts, the surface is graded to shed water, and we hand off a clean site with your warranty in writing.

Frequently Asked Questions

How much does a retaining wall cost?

Cost is driven by length, height, wall type, site access, and how much drainage and excavation the site needs. Short timber landscape walls are the least expensive; tall engineered concrete walls with full drainage cost the most. We give a fixed written price after seeing the site — estimates are free.

Do I need a permit or an engineer for a retaining wall?

It depends on height and location. Many jurisdictions on the Western Slope require engineering and a permit above roughly four feet, or when a wall surcharges a structure or road. We tell you what your specific site needs and handle the plans.

How long does a retaining wall last?

A properly based and drained concrete wall commonly lasts several decades. Timber walls typically last 15 to 20 years depending on moisture. Drainage is the single biggest factor in either case.

Can you build a wall to stop erosion on my property?

Yes — erosion control is one of our most common retaining wall requests. We combine the wall with grading and drainage so runoff is redirected instead of just blocked.

Can you terrace a steep slope into usable yard?

Yes. Tiered walls turn an unusable slope into level planting beds, patios, or lawn. We design the tier spacing so each wall carries only the load it is built for.

How long does construction take?

Most residential walls are finished in a few days to a week and a half, depending on length, height, access, and whether an existing wall has to come out first.
